What the Virus $111.53 Antivirus software is a key security technology on todays end user systems. Current antivirus engines use two complementary techniques to detect malware. One is to statically scan potential malware sample files for certain patterns which are known ( malware signatures ). The other is to dynamically detect typical malicious behavior (e.g., modifications of registry keys, DLL injections etc.) upon execution of a sample. No antivirus product can reliably detect malware. Rather, all products are plagued by false positives and false negatives. An interesting approach to improve the reliability of detection is to run several antivirus products on a given malware sample. There are several online scanning services, that implement this approach. However, for performance reasons these services only use the static signature detection functionality of the anti virus products, and thus do not take advantage of the full functionality of current antivirus engines. This book explains how to overcome this limitation and to build an efficient online malware scanning service that fully utilizes the capabilities of current antivirus engines. Koko (Computer Virus) $68.51 High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les KOKO Virus is a memory resident parasitic virus created on March 1991. It hooks INT 21h and writes itself to the end of COM and EXE files that are executed. On July 29 and February 15 it displays a message and erases the disk sectors, and the next day everything goes back to normal. In 1991, an Egyptian Engineer Developed the virus for testing and research purposes, become the first Virus Creator in Middle East for EXE COM TSR Virus over DOS and workgroup windows, after a straight order from the government he release the antivirus (AAV Adham Anti Virus ). the virus spread fast and easily and it became one of the famous names KOKO in Memory resident Viruses.
